While one part of the referendum was implemented, another part was ignored: Jamaat Ameer


Amir of Bangladesh Jamaat-e-Islami and opposition leader of the parliament. Shafiqur Rahman said, ‘Change and amendment of the constitution is the demand of the nation. We hope the government will meet this demand soon. 65 percent of people voted yes in the election. They want reform. But the desire of people is not being realized. While one part of the referendum has been implemented, another part has remained neglected so far.’

Amir of Jamaat said these things at the meeting of Eid greetings and exchange of views with journalists at Sylhet Circuit House on Sunday (March 22). Various media workers working in the district participated in the meeting. At this time opposition leader Shafiqur Rahman answered various questions of journalists.

President Md. Regarding Sahabuddin, Jamaat’s Amir said, ‘This president was practically associated with fascism. We did not want him to address the Parliament. We have no objection to the institution of the President, we have objection to the person.’ Dr. requested the government party to get rid of this matter. Shafiqur Rahman.

Shafiqur Rahman said, “Although a large part of fascism has left, its black shadow still remains. After the national election, the country turned around after the political change, but the crisis is not over yet. There is a trend of disorder, chaos and revenge in the society. The law and order situation in the country is alarming and incidents of violence are happening at various places, which is unfortunate. People’s trust in politics has decreased as politicians’ words do not match their actions. Responsible behavior of political parties is essential to build an accountable and just society.’

Regarding the referendum and reforms, the leader of the opposition party in the parliament said, “Even though the people voted for the change, it was not fully implemented. In this situation, there is a danger of creating mistrust among people again.’

Shafiqur Rahman complained of extra fare collection during Eid trips and said, ‘Strict action should be taken against such irregularities. Government should be more responsible in protecting people’s money and interests. We will play a constructive role inside and outside the Parliament as an opposition party. But I will not compromise to protect people’s rights.

Jamaat Amir said, ‘I did not boycott the last election to create a new and positive trend of politics. As in the past, we did not immediately reject the election. We said, we accepted the election with pressure on our chest. Still, organizations like TIB (Transparency International), Sujan (Citizens for Good Governance) have expressed their views on the election. We think these reports will be helpful to understand how the last election was done.

Shafiqur Rahman said, ‘When coming to Sylhet from Dhaka by road, whenever I came across various places, I said “Welcome to Sylhet”, but in reality, the lack of development in various sectors including roads is obvious. Not only roads, Sylhet’s due in all sectors should be ensured. We don’t want anything extra, we just want fair rights.’

Amir of Jamaat also said, ‘To ensure the development of Sylhet, specific planning and implementation is necessary from the government. As an opposition party, we will raise demands on behalf of the people, but the responsibility of implementation lies with the government.

Regarding the local government elections, Shafiqur Rahman said, ‘Fast local government elections are necessary to strengthen democracy at the grassroots level. People’s work should be done through public representatives, so that accountability is ensured.’

Jamaat Amir praised the tradition and social solidarity of journalist society of Sylhet in the exchange meeting and said, ‘The responsible role of journalists plays an important role in leading the society in the right direction.’
